Helping get beef into the homes of food insecure


2025-02-06 - Columbia, KY - Photo by Linda Waggener, ColumbiaMagazine.com.
Nick Roy, Agent for Agriculture & Natural Resources in the Adair County Cooperative Extension Service, pictured at left, led organization of the new beef-up-the-pantry partnership which will benefit both Adair County cattle producers and the Adair County Food Pantry. Vicky Pike, center, in front, owner of Miss Vicky's Pampered Angus Ranch in New Columbia, was the first to donate a cow to the new program.

Pictured are members of the Cattlemen's Association along with Adair Food Pantry. From left in back, are: Nick Roy, Debbie Bracket, Lenny Stone, Richard Phelps, Joe Flowers, Deanna Grider and Mark Baker. From left in the front row are: Connie Devore, Loretta Darling, Vicky Pike, Robert Flowers and Trilby Vance. (Not pictured are Stephen Breeding, John Wethington and Brett Smith.)
